news 2026/5/3 13:41:27

通过 curl 命令快速测试 Taotoken API 密钥与端点的连通性

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
通过 curl 命令快速测试 Taotoken API 密钥与端点的连通性

通过 curl 命令快速测试 Taotoken API 密钥与端点的连通性

1. 准备工作

在开始测试之前,请确保您已经完成以下准备工作:首先,登录 Taotoken 控制台并创建一个 API Key。其次,在模型广场中查看您希望调用的模型 ID,例如claude-sonnet-4-6或其他支持的模型。最后,确认您的终端环境已安装 curl 工具,这是大多数 Linux/macOS 系统的内置命令,Windows 用户可通过 Git Bash 或 WSL 使用。

2. 构造基础 curl 命令

Taotoken 的 OpenAI 兼容 API 端点位于https://taotoken.net/api/v1/chat/completions。以下是最基础的 curl 命令结构,用于发送聊天补全请求:

curl -s "https://taotoken.net/api/v1/chat/completions" \ -H "Authorization: Bearer YOUR_API_KEY" \ -H "Content-Type: application/json" \ -d '{"model":"MODEL_ID","messages":[{"role":"user","content":"Hello"}]}'

请将YOUR_API_KEY替换为您的实际 API Key,MODEL_ID替换为目标模型 ID。-s参数用于静默模式,避免输出进度信息干扰结果查看。

3. 处理常见响应与错误

当命令执行后,您可能会遇到以下几种典型响应情况:

成功响应(HTTP 200)将返回 JSON 格式的补全结果,包含choices数组和生成的文本内容。例如:

{ "id": "chatcmpl-123", "object": "chat.completion", "created": 1677652288, "model": "claude-sonnet-4-6", "choices": [{ "index": 0, "message": { "role": "assistant", "content": "Hello! How can I help you today?" }, "finish_reason": "stop" }], "usage": { "prompt_tokens": 5, "completion_tokens": 10, "total_tokens": 15 } }

认证失败(HTTP 401)通常表示 API Key 错误或未提供:

{"error":{"message":"Invalid API Key","type":"invalid_request_error"}}

模型不存在(HTTP 404)可能由于模型 ID 拼写错误或未授权:

{"error":{"message":"The model does not exist","type":"invalid_request_error"}}

配额不足(HTTP 429)提示当前 Key 的额度已耗尽:

{"error":{"message":"You exceeded your current quota","type":"insufficient_quota"}}

4. 高级调试技巧

对于更复杂的调试需求,可以通过以下方式增强 curl 命令:

添加-v参数查看完整的 HTTP 请求与响应头信息,有助于诊断网络问题:

curl -v "https://taotoken.net/api/v1/chat/completions" ...

使用-o将响应保存到文件便于后续分析:

curl -o response.json "https://taotoken.net/api/v1/chat/completions" ...

如需测试超长文本,可通过@符号从文件读取消息体:

curl -d @request.json "https://taotoken.net/api/v1/chat/completions" ...

其中request.json文件内容示例:

{ "model": "claude-sonnet-4-6", "messages": [ {"role": "system", "content": "You are a helpful assistant."}, {"role": "user", "content": "Explain the concept of API testing."} ] }

5. 安全注意事项

始终确保 API Key 不被泄露。在共享命令历史或日志时,务必删除或替换敏感信息。建议将 Key 存储在环境变量中动态引用:

curl -H "Authorization: Bearer $TAOTOKEN_API_KEY" ...

对于生产环境,应通过密钥管理服务或配置文件安全地处理认证信息,避免硬编码。


如需了解更多功能或获取 API Key,请访问 Taotoken。

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/5/3 13:41:25

简单三步:让B站缓存视频重获新生的终极解决方案

简单三步:让B站缓存视频重获新生的终极解决方案 【免费下载链接】m4s-converter 一个跨平台小工具,将bilibili缓存的m4s格式音视频文件合并成mp4 项目地址: https://gitcode.com/gh_mirrors/m4/m4s-converter 你是否曾经历过这样的场景&#xff1…

作者头像 李华
网站建设 2026/5/3 13:40:50

Dism++:免费开源的Windows系统终极优化神器

Dism:免费开源的Windows系统终极优化神器 【免费下载链接】Dism-Multi-language Dism Multi-language Support & BUG Report 项目地址: https://gitcode.com/gh_mirrors/di/Dism-Multi-language 想要让Windows系统重获新生?Dism正是你需要的完…

作者头像 李华
网站建设 2026/5/3 13:34:56

从零构建可自托管的AI智能体:轻量级框架nanobot实战指南

1. 项目概述:从零构建一个轻量级、可自托管的AI智能体 如果你和我一样,对市面上的AI Agent框架感到既兴奋又头疼——功能强大但架构复杂,上手门槛高,想自己动手改点东西都得在层层抽象里迷路——那么今天聊的这个项目&#xff0c…

作者头像 李华
网站建设 2026/5/3 13:31:27

快速搭建deerflow2.0本地环境:用快马AI一键生成部署脚本原型

最近在尝试本地部署deerflow2.0工作流引擎时,发现手动配置环境特别耗时。作为一个开源工作流引擎,它需要处理Python版本、依赖包、系统权限等各种问题。经过几次折腾后,我摸索出一个用Python脚本自动化部署的方案,现在把整个过程记…

作者头像 李华
网站建设 2026/5/3 13:31:22

69、【Agent】【OpenCode】用户对话提示词(system-reminder)

【声明】本博客所有内容均为个人业余时间创作,所述技术案例均来自公开开源项目(如Github,Apache基金会),不涉及任何企业机密或未公开技术,如有侵权请联系删除 背景 上篇 blog 【Agent】【OpenCode】用户对…

作者头像 李华
网站建设 2026/5/3 13:29:48

Ultimate SD Upscale完整指南:三步实现AI图像高清放大

Ultimate SD Upscale完整指南:三步实现AI图像高清放大 【免费下载链接】ultimate-upscale-for-automatic1111 项目地址: https://gitcode.com/gh_mirrors/ul/ultimate-upscale-for-automatic1111 Ultimate SD Upscale是专为AUTOMATIC1111 Stable Diffusion …

作者头像 李华